Output 51936811598308d1813c6c443c517dfbb1e3bc8b37d73918a38a9c278a543cb8:0

value
20102000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97014b09e68b6a93eac72c042654449b7b7d8272 OP_EQUAL
address
3FTTWMhWmdjCx4AfmjqHjd6mMDTqchoA82
transaction
51936811598308d1813c6c443c517dfbb1e3bc8b37d73918a38a9c278a543cb8
confirmations
356843
spent
true